Internet cafes
🌍
Mauritania
Added August 10, 2025
TOP DEFINITION
مقاهي الإنترنت (Internet cafes)
"Opening internet cafes locally (Opening internet cafes locally)"
by
Khulekani Dladla
August 10, 2025
0